Ruptured Vertebral Artery Dissection Treated with Endovascular Intervention

Endovascular treatment effectively manages vertebral artery dissecting aneurysms (VADA) causing subarachnoid hemorrhage, preventing complications. Understanding dissection patterns aids in preventing rupture and ischemic events.

Background:
- Vertebral artery dissecting aneurysms (VADA) are a significant cause of subarachnoid hemorrhage (SAH).
- Optimal treatment strategies for VADA remain an area of active research.
Purpose of the Study:
- To evaluate the outcomes of endovascular treatment for VADA with SAH.
- To analyze VADA cases based on anatomical patterns and explore potential rupture factors.
Main Methods:
- Retrospective analysis of 11 VADA cases with SAH treated at Ota Memorial Hospital.
- Classification of VADA based on posterior inferior cerebellar artery (PICA) involvement.
- Inclusion of computational fluid dynamics (CFD) analysis in one bilateral VADA case.
Main Results:
- Endovascular treatment was performed in 8 of 11 VADA patients with SAH.
- No postoperative ischemic complications or rebleeding were observed.
- CFD analysis suggested potential rupture factors including wall shear stress and oscillatory shear index.
Conclusions:
- Tailored treatment strategies based on PICA branching patterns can prevent VADA rupture and ischemic complications.
- Predicting rupture in bilateral VADA is crucial for timely and appropriate intervention.
